While the current latest version of i1Profiler is v3.8.6 as of late 2025, i1Profiler 3.1.1 remains a critical download for users of 1st Generation i1Pro (Rev. A–D) hardware, as support for these devices was dropped in all subsequent versions (3.2.0 and higher). Why You Might Need i1Profiler 3.1.1
Legacy Hardware Support: It is the final stable version to support the original i1Pro spectrophotometer (1st Gen).
Operating System Compatibility: It is the designated version for users running macOS 10.12.6 (Sierra) and specific Windows builds where newer versions may not be compatible.
Stability for Older Devices: Users of i1Display Pro or i1Pro 2 who encounter issues with newer releases often revert to 3.1.1 for its proven stability on older workstations. Key Features and Capabilities
Even as a legacy version, 3.1.1 offers a professional toolset for color management:
Dual User Interfaces: Choose between a "Basic" wizard-driven mode and an "Advanced" mode for full control over profile parameters. i1profiler 311 download new
Comprehensive Profiling: Create custom ICC profiles for monitors, projectors, and printers (supporting up to 8-color workflows).
Iterative Technology: Uses the i1Prism engine to optimize profiles based on specific images or spot colors. Common Installation Issues
The most frequently reported issue with version 3.1.1 is the "OpenCL.dll is missing" error on Windows.
The Fix: This is typically resolved by updating your video card drivers.
Alternative: If driver updates fail, manually copying the OpenCL.dll file into your System32 (32-bit) or SysWOW64 (64-bit) folder may be required. How to Download and Install

Reconnect: Plug your measurement instrument back in. 4. Important Device Support Changes (2026) i1Pro 2 Support:
The i1Pro 2 family of devices reached end of service on Jan 1, 2025, and is no longer supported in i1Profiler as of January 1, 2026. i1Display Support:
i1Profiler 3.7.1 and higher (3.8.x) is the last version to support legacy i1Display Pro devices, as they move to Calibrite software. 5. Troubleshooting Connection Problems: The Photographer's Quest for Color Accuracy Meet Emma,
If the device isn't detected, restart the i1ProfilerTray application. Old Software Conflict:
Installing older X-Rite software can cause connection issues. Reinstall i1Profiler to restore updated drivers.
